Technical Field
[0001] The present invention relates to the technical field of 3D laser printing, and in particular to a laser beam collaborative scanning system. Background Art
[0002] Among various laser scanning technologies, SLM is currently the most widely used laser scanning technology. In the current SLM technology, a single galvanometer is used to scan and process the powder in the forming area. For large workpieces, its processing efficiency is low. Therefore, in order to improve processing efficiency, the current method is to use a high-efficiency galvanometer system to improve processing efficiency by improving laser scanning efficiency. However, this efficiency adjustment capability is limited, and the high-efficiency galvanometer system is expensive, making it difficult to widely use. Summary of the Invention
[0003] In order to make up for the above shortcomings, the present invention provides a laser beam collaborative scanning system, which divides the forming area of the forming chamber into multiple scanning partitions, and uses multiple gro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ems to synchronously scan the multiple scanning partitions independently, thereby greatly improving the workpiece processing efficiency.
[0004] In order to solve its technical problems, the technical solution adopted by the present invention is: it includes a forming chamber, a laser scanning galvanometer system and a control system, at least two gro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ems are arranged above the forming chamber, and the forming area of the forming chamber forms at least two independent scanning partitions. The laser beam emitted by each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ems corresponds to a scanning partition, and the control system controls each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ems to independently scan each scanning partition at the same time.
[0005] As a further improvement of the invention, the scanning range of the laser beam of the laser scanning galvanometer system is larger than the corresponding scanning partition range.
[0006] As a further improvement of the invention, the forming area of the forming chamber is divided into 15 independent scanning partitions, and 15 gro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ems are arranged above the forming chamber.
[0007] As a further improvement of the invention, the top plate of the forming chamber is a step structure of different heights, and 15 gro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ems are distributed on different step structures. The laser scanning galvanometer systems on the step structures of different heights are arranged in a staggered state in the height direction and in an interlaced and stacked state in the horizontal direction. The focal lengths of the laser scanning galvanometer systems on different step structures are different, and the focus of each laser scanning galvanometer system is located on the same forming plane.
[0008] As a further improvement of the invention, the top plate of the forming chamber forms a "convex" shaped structure with a middle height higher than the heights on both sides, wherein 5 gro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ems are evenly distributed on the step structure with a high middle height, and 5 gro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ems are distributed on each of the step structures with low heights on both sides, and the laser scanning galvanometer systems on the steps with low heights on both sides are arranged symmetrically, and the 5 gro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ems on the step structure with a high middle height and the laser scanning galvanometer systems on the steps with low heights on either side are distributed in an overlapping and staggered state.
[0009] As a further improvement of the invention, the nominal scanning area of each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ems is 550×550mm 2 The actual scanning area of each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ems distributed on the low-height step structures on both sides is 300×200mm 2 The actual scanning area of each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ems distributed on the middle high step structure is 400×200mm 2 .
[0010] As a further improvement of the invention, each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ems scans in the forming chamber along the wind speed direction of the adverse wind field.
[0011] As a further improvement of the invention, each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ems adopts a two-dimensional digitally driven galvanometer.
[0012] The beneficial technical effect of the present invention is: the present invention abandons the traditional concept of improving laser forming efficiency, divides the forming area of the forming chamber into multiple independent scanning partitions, and simultaneously emits multiple groups of laser beams through multiple gro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ems to synchronously scan each scanning partition. Since the scanning area corresponding to each pair of laser scanning galvanometer systems is very small, the scanning speed is very fast, thereby realizing efficient processing of the workpiece, and the processing efficiency can be doubled without the use of a high-efficiency galvanometer system. By longitudinally dislocating the multiple gro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ems above the forming chamber, the stacked and staggered installation of multiple gro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ems can be realized, and the increase in the forming chamber area can be avoided. [0018] Embodiment: A laser beam collaborative scanning system includes a forming chamber 1, a laser scanning galvanometer system 2 and a control system. At least two gro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 are arranged above the forming chamber 1. The forming area of the forming chamber 1 forms at least two independent scanning partitions 3. The laser beam 4 emitted by each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ems corresponds to a scanning partition 3. The control system controls each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 to independently scan each scanning partition 3 at the same time.
[0019] During laser cladding forming processing, each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 scans and processes the corresponding scanning partition 3 according to the design requirements. Since the scanning area responsible for each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 is small, it can achieve high-speed processing and greatly improve the processing efficiency. In addition, the area corresponding to the laser beam 4 of each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 is small, which ensures that the laser scanning spot is always the optimal spot and the product scanning accuracy is high.
[0020] The scanning range of the laser beam 4 of the laser scanning galvanometer system 2 is larger than the range of the corresponding scanning partition 3. This ensures that every point in the partition can be scanned to avoid blind spots.
[0021] The forming area of the forming chamber 1 is divided into 15 independent scanning zones 3, and 15 gro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 are disposed above the forming chamber 1. The 15 gro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 simultaneously scan the 15 scanning zones 3, resulting in high scanning efficiency. Of course, other numbers of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2, such as 10 or 20 groups, may also be used. This is a choice freely made by those skilled in the art based on this patent and actual circumstances, and all such choices fall within the scope of protection of this application.
[0022] The top plate of the forming chamber 1 is a step structure 5 of different heights, and 15 gro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 are distributed on different step structures 5. The laser scanning galvanometer systems on the step structures 5 of different heights are arranged in a staggered state in the height direction and arranged in a staggered and stacked state in the horizontal direction. The focal lengths of the laser scanning galvanometer systems on the different step structures 5 are different, and the focus of each laser scanning galvanometer system is located on the same forming plane. When the 15 gro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 are arranged above the forming chamber 1, they are arranged in a layered and staggered manner, and the staggering is achieved through the longitudinal height difference, which effectively reduces the area occupied by the laser scanning galvanometer system 2 in the horizontal direction, and realizes the effective arrangement of the 15 gro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 within a limited area, so that the laser beams 4 of the 15 gro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 are evenly and effectively projected onto each scanning partition 3 for laser scanning processing, avoiding increasing the area of the forming chamber 1.
[0023] The top plate of the forming chamber 1 forms a "convex"-shaped structure with a middle height higher than the heights on both sides. Five groups of laser scanning galvanometer mirror systems 2 are evenly spaced on the high-center step structure 5, and five groups of laser scanning galvanometer mirror systems 2 are each distributed on the low-level step structures 5 on both sides. The laser scanning galvanometer mirror systems 2 on the low-level steps on both sides are arranged symmetrically, and the five groups of laser scanning galvanometer mirror systems 2 on the high-center step structure 5 are stacked and staggered with the laser scanning galvanometer mirror systems 2 on either side of the low-level steps. The "convex"-shaped forming top surface design allows the 15 groups of laser scanning galvanometer mirror systems 2 to be evenly and symmetrically arranged above the forming chamber 1, enabling simultaneous and efficient processing of the 15 scanning zones 3.
[0024] The nominal scanning area of each group of laser scanning galvanometer system 2 is 550×550mm 2 The actual scanning area of each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 distributed on the low-height step structures 5 on both sides is 300×200mm 2 The actual scanning area of each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 distributed on the middle high step structure 5 is 400×200mm 2 .
[0025] The nominal scanning area of each group of laser scanning galvanometer system 2 is 550×550mm 2 , and the scanning area of each galvanometer in the 10 groups of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 on both sides is 300×200mm 2 The scanning area of each galvanometer in the central 5 groups of laser scanning galvanometer system 2 is 400×200mm 2 Each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 can scan within its corresponding scanning area 3. When a laser scanning galvanometer system 2 is damaged, the adjacent laser scanning galvanometer system 2 can replace it to perform cross-area scanning. That is, the maximum scanning area of each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 is 400×400mm 2 The diameter of the light spot changes by only 2μm during the scanning process, and the scanning accuracy is high.
[0026] Each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 scans in the forming chamber 1 along the wind speed direction against the wind field, which can fully ensure the scanning accuracy.
[0027] Each group of laser scanning galvanometer systems 2 adopts a two-dimensional digitally driven galvanometer.
